The right deck stain does more than just look good—it also extends the life of your wood by providing a protective layer against moisture, UV rays, and wear. The stain color you choose can transform the look of your outdoor space and should reflect both your personal style and the architectural character of your home.

The color of your home’s siding, trim, and roofing should influence your deck stain choice. Aim for a complementary color that enhances the overall aesthetics.
Always test the stain on a small, inconspicuous area of your deck or on a spare piece of wood. This will give you a true idea of how the color will look once applied and dried.
Darker stains might require more frequent maintenance as they can show dust and pollen more readily than lighter colors. Consider your willingness to upkeep as part of your color decision.

Typically, decks should be restained every 2-3 years, but this can vary based on the stain type and your deck’s exposure to elements.
Yes, deck stains can be custom mixed to achieve a specific shade. This is a great option if you're looking for a unique look.
While the color itself doesn’t impact protection, darker stains tend to absorb more UV rays, which can increase their protective qualities against sun damage.
Deck stain can be applied with a brush, roller, or sprayer. Each method has its benefits, but using a brush helps ensure the stain gets into the wood grain, providing better protection.
Yes, there are several eco-friendly stains available that are low in vol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and safer for the environment.
